"Prices aren't going to go much lower and interest rates are creeping [up] a little bit," Hamilton said of the housing market. "It is improving all the time."
Hamilton said that Wilson County has survived in the real estate market by adjusting their level of supply and demand.
"Real estate is very local. Fortunately, we didn't have the huge bubble that busted. We just had to adjust to the overall housing market. Things are still selling pretty close to asking price. There are exceptions though – there are foreclosures," she said.
November residential real estate sales in Wilson County improved.October ended with 144 closed residential single family homes with a median sales price of $181,390.
"Median days on the market of 87, and 154 homes going under contract for future closing dates," Hamilton added.
Hamilton said inventory dropped slightly to 8.2 months, and that it is still very much a buyer's market.
Removing the new construction numbers from the equation and looking at only existing home sales, the median sales price is $159,500 with a median days on the market of 79 and median sales price per square footage of $85.16.
Hamilton said Lebanon produced 52 sales in October – eight of which were new construction and six of which were foreclosure/short sales.
"The median sales price of existing residential homes is $140,000 with median days on the market of 104 and median sales price per square footage of $82.74," she said.
Hamilton said Mt. Juliet continues to dominate the county in sales.
"Providence is a huge draw. Plus it is close to the airport and people have the commuter train [Music City Star]," she said. "Many have been coming into Providence Del Webb Communites from other areas. I've seen a lot of first time buyers who were raised in Wilson County TN Real Estate market and are staying here."Hamilton said it is all about the individual's needs when buying a home.
"Schools are important to a lot of people. To some people being close to the interstate is important."
Mt. Juliet produced 79 sales in October – 36 of those sales were new construction and 14 were foreclosure/short sale. Twenty-nine of the home sold were existing resale homes. The existing home median price in Mt. Juliet TN Real Estate is $173,365 and median price per square footage is $86.22.
Watertown had two sales, one of which was a foreclosure.
Hamilton said she hopes to see serious buyers ready to move during the holiday breaks.
"The demand is going to be there and the supply is going to be there. We just have to keep working hard, keep pushing and doing what we do," she said. "Real estate is an investment.
